Trenching Service in Salt Lake City, UT

Trenching services involve digging narrow, deep channels into the ground to facilitate the installation or maintenance of underground utilities, such as water lines, electrical cables, drainage systems, or irrigation pipes. These services are often used for projects that require precise and controlled excavation, including laying new utility lines, upgrading existing infrastructure, or creating pathways for underground wiring. Property owners typically want to understand the scope of trenching, the depth and width of the trenches, and how the work might impact their landscaping or existing structures before requesting service.

Before requesting trenching services, property owners should consider the location of underground utilities, property boundaries, and any local regulations or permits that may apply. It’s also useful to determine the intended purpose of the trenches and the type of soil or terrain involved, as these factors can influence the planning and execution of the project. Clear communication about project goals and site conditions can help ensure the trenching work proceeds smoothly and meets the specific needs of the property.

Project Types

Common Trenching Service Jobs

Utility Line Installation - trenches are used to lay electrical, water, or gas lines safely underground.

Drainage Solutions - trenches help improve yard drainage and prevent water pooling around foundations.

Foundation Support - trenching provides access for foundation repairs or underpinning work.

Irrigation System Setup - trenches facilitate the installation of sprinkler and irrigation systems.

Fence and Barrier Installation - trenching creates a stable base for fences and property boundaries.

Drain Tile and Sewer Work - trenches are essential for installing or repairing drain tiles and sewer lines.

FAQ

Trenching Service Questions

What is trenching service used for? Trenching is often used to install utilities like water, gas, or electrical lines underground, or for drainage and irrigation systems.

What types of projects require trenching? Projects such as laying pipes, wiring, or creating foundation footings typically need trenching services.

How deep are trenches usually dug? Trenches are generally dug to a depth suitable for the project, often between 12 to 36 inches, depending on the purpose.

What should property owners consider before trenching? It's important to identify underground utilities and understand local regulations before beginning trenching work.
